First Thursdays: “Eulogy: A Holocaust Art Piece” by Burton R

Thu 1 Sep, 6:30-8:30 pm. Holocaust Museum Houston will host a special presentation by Burton Reckles, an internationally recognized artisan whose Glass Encapsulated Miniatures (GEMS) have been displayed in museums around the world, as he speaks about his latest artwork “Eulogy” and how it is related to his discovery of the loss of his family members during the Holocaust. The practitioner of a 400-year-old art form, sometimes referred to as “ships in bottles,” turned his talents to creating GEMS pieces related to both antisemistism and the events of the 20th century’s greatest genocide after discovering that his great-grandmother and two great-aunts were murdered in the Holocaust. “Eulogy” serves as a memorial to them. White Water Rafting on the Dead River

Sun 4 Sep, 8:30-4:30 am. Jewish Community Alliance of Southern Maine Cost: $90.00 When: September 04, 2011 | 08:30 AM to 04:30 PM Where: North Country Rivers, Rt 201, Bingham, ME 04920 The Dead River can only be paddled on 13 dam release days during the season. On Labor Day Weekend, the release is of 5,500 cubic feet of water per second, making for class 4 rapids down the most continuous whitewater in New England. After suiting up, learning basic strokes and crew teamwork, we will be on a 16 mile gorgeous passage through pristine forests for about 4.5 hours with a break for a bbq lunch on shore. Poland

Tue 13 Sep to Tue 20 Sep. For Jewish travelers, a tour to Poland may be a difficult yet essential journey. The statistics themselves are harrowing: During the Holocaust, 90% of Poland’s three million Jews were annihilated. Still, Jewish roots go centuries-deep in this country, and we have made great contributions to it. In the past, Jewish travel to Poland was limited to Krakow and Warsaw. Today, however, one can see other important historical sights, as well as the vivid present-day return of a Jewish Poland. To create a more in-depth experience for the sophisticated Jewish traveler, we now also include Tykocin, Kazimiers Dolny, Lublin,Lezajsk, Lancut, Wroclaw, Lodz and more – all featuring new sights and new insights into our complex and continuing life in this part of the world. 1835 NE Miami Gardens Dr. Suite 150, Miami, 33179. 305-466-0652. An Architectural History of Rodeph Shalom

Tue 13 Sep, 12 pm. Lunch & Learn Tuesday, September 13, 2011 at 12:00PM Occurs: On the second Tuesday of every month An Architectural History of Rodeph Shalom, Michael Hauptman, AIA This Lunch & Learn will explore the architectural history of Rodeph Shalom. The presentation will look at the design of the 1870 Frank Furness building that once occupied the current site as well as the design of our current building, designed in 1927 by Simon & Simon. We will learn about the architectural styles of the two buildings and compare them to other works by the same architects. 615 North Broad Street, Philadelphia, 19123-2495.
